How much does it cost to repair a gas leak?
| Repair costs for gas pipes. Repair gas leaks for $ 6 to $ 7 per linear foot or $ 75 to $ 150 per hour. The place where the leak occurs determines the cost of the repair. Repairing a gas line with a single machine costs an average of $ 150 to $ 650, depending on the distance, location, and material of the pipeline.

Is a gas leak also covered by home insurance?
Gas leaks in homes often come from multiple sources. Damage to appliances is usually not covered by home insurance. Check your insurance details to see if they are covered. If unavoidable damage occurs on a line, home insurance is more likely to cover the cost.

How do installers check for gas leaks?
If you install a gas pipe yourself, forget about these leaks:
- Apply soapy water to each connection on the gas line.
- Turn on the gas and check for air bubbles.
- If air bubbles form, lightly tighten the screw connection with a socket wrench and check again.

Is it a gas leak detector?
So in the event of a possible gas leak, your best detector is your nose. You can supplement your sense of smell with a natural gas detector, many of which also test for propane and carbon monoxide.

Does the gas company correct gas leaks?
If you suspect a gas leak, contact your gas supplier immediately. The gas company technician, if he hears it, will shut off the gas supply for safety reasons and determine the cause of the leak. However, the gas company will not solve the problem of having to call a plumber or HVAC expert.
Who should I call if I smell gas from my stove?
If you smell gas and the stove is off, leave the house as soon as possible and call 112. Then call your natural gas supplier (your instrument). (Natural gas and propane are scented to help homeowners / customers locate leaks.)
